实时搜索: java常用的类有哪些

java常用的类有哪些

875条评论 1583人喜欢 2501次阅读 380人点赞
有哪几个常用的类重写了equals()方法,使得equals()比较内容,不比较引用是否指向同一对象?

我只知道String类,还有么? , 自己看尚学堂的视频都看得我一头雾水 就是在那创建文件夹 创建文件。
顺便说下枚举类型有什么用,1楼啊,我就是在网上看也看不出这个File有什么用才来问的,不是什么都没查过就来问的。请不要说废话。。3Q ...

Java中的异常类型有哪些?: try{
你要抓的有可能发生异常的代码

}catch(你要抓的异常代码会出现的类型在这加个变量名代表这种类型){
一旦异常出现,这代码块里面的代码会被执行
}finally{
这里的代码是即使出现异常或者没有出现异常,这段代码都会被执行
}

另外要注意的是,声明catch的类型的时候~~要从小到大的声明会抛出的异常
,比如说有人问你怎么去中山一路,你应该要先告诉他你先坐什么车再坐什么车,不应该直接说坐车就能去到了.

java math类有哪些常用方法: static double abs(double a)
返回 double 值的绝对值。
static float abs(float a)
返回 float 值的绝对值。
static int abs(int a)
返回 int 值的绝对值。
static long abs(long a)
返回 long 值的绝对值。
static double acos(double a)
返回角的反余弦,范围在 0.0 到 pi 之间。
static double asin(double a)
返回角的反正弦,范围在 -pi/2 到 pi/2 之间。
static double atan(double a)
返回角的反正切,范围在 -pi/2 到 pi/2 之间。
static double atan2(double y, double x)
将矩形坐标 (x, y) 转换成极坐标 (r, theta)。
static double cbrt(double a)
返回 double 值的立方根。
static double ceil(double a)
返回最小的(最接近负无穷大)double 值,该值大于或等于参数,并且等于某个整数。
static double cos(double a)
返回角的三角余弦。
static double cosh(double x)
返回 double 值的双曲线余弦。
static double exp(double a)
返回欧拉数 e 的 double 次幂的值。
static double expm1(double x)
返回 ex -1。
static double floor(double a)
返回最大的(最接近正无穷大)double 值,该值小于或等于参数,并且等于某个整数。
static double hypot(double x, double y)
返回 sqrt(x2 +y2),没有中间溢出或下溢。
static double IEEEremainder(double f1, double f2)
按照 IEEE 754 标准的规定,对两个参数进行余数运算。
static double log(double a)
返回(底数是 e)double 值的自然对数。
static double log10(double a)
返回 double 值的底数为 10 的对数。
static double log1p(double x)
返回参数与 1 的和的自然对数。
static double max(double a, double b)
返回两个 double 值中较大的一个。
static float max(float a, float b)
返回两个 float 值中较大的一个。
static int max(int a, int b)
返回两个 int 值中较大的一个。
static long max(long a, long b)
返回两个 long 值中较大的一个。
static double min(double a, double b)
返回两个 double 值中较小的一个。
static float min(float a, float b)
返回两个 float 值中较小的一个。
static int min(int a, int b)
返回两个 int 值中较小的一个。
static long min(long a, long b)
返回两个 long 值中较小的一个。
static double pow(double a, double b)
返回第一个参数的第二个参数次幂的值。
static double random()
返回带正号的 double 值,大于或等于 0.0,小于 1.0。
static double rint(double a)
返回其值最接近参数并且是整数的 double 值。
static long round(double a)
返回最接近参数的 long。
static int round(float a)
返回最接近参数的 int。
static double signum(double d)
返回参数的符号函数;如果参数是零,则返回零;如果参数大于零,则返回 1.0;如果参数小于零,则返回 -1.0。
static float signum(float f)
返回参数的符号函数;如果参数是零,则返回零;如果参数大于零,则返回 1.0;如果参数小于零,则返回 -1.0。
static double sin(double a)
返回角的三角正弦。
static double sinh(double x)
返回 double 值的双曲线正弦。
static double sqrt(double a)
返回正确舍入的 double 值的正平方根。
static double tan(double a)
返回角的三角正切。
static double tanh(double x)
返回 double 值的双曲线余弦。
static double toDegrees(double angrad)
将用弧度测量的角转换为近似相等的用度数测量的角。
static double toRadians(double angdeg)
将用度数测量的角转换为近似相等的用弧度测量的角。
static double ulp(double d)
返回参数的 ulp 大小。
static float ulp(float f)
返回参数的 ulp 大小。

从api上截的,更详细的还是推荐查看api

JAVA中类的继承有什么优点?:

1、继承关系是传递的。若类C继承类B,类B继承类A,则类C既有从类B那里继承下来的属性与方法,也有从类A那里继承下来的属性与方法,继承来的属性和方法尽管是隐式的,但仍是类C的属性和方法。继承是在一些比较一般的类的基础上构造、建立和扩充新类的最有效的手段;

2、继承简化了人们对事物的认识和描述,能清晰体现相关类间的层次结构关系;继承提供了软件复用功能。这种做法能减小代码和数据的冗余度,大大增加程序的重用性;提供多重继承机制。出于安全性和可靠性的考虑,仅支持单重继承,而通过使用接口机制来实现多重继承。

java 有哪几个常用的类重写了equals()方法?: 这样和你说吧 不知道你有没有API API里的类大部分都重写了 什么样没重写你记好了 就是比如你自己写一个persion类 就没有重写 因为你自己写的谁知道啊 一般都重写了 象8种基本引用类型 象DATE 还有好多 你去查API 使用equals一般只要各种数据相同就是同一种 不再比较在计算机中的内存地址 如果没有重写 首先比较在计算机的内存地址 即使数据都相同 内存地址是不同的 所以也不相等

我用jQuery调用java业务类的方法这样有什么问题: 没有——————————————————————————

java中类的继承对父类有什么要求: 父类只要不是final的都可以被继承

Java运行环境扩展中的类是什么意思?: 有一个问题可能跟你提的是同一个意思。
问题:有一种方法可以在运行时在java中添加(或扩展现有的)类。我遇到了一个问题,其中我必须在运行时扩展一个现有的类,并将其添加到类路径,以便这个新类被拾起。
解决方案:
有很多方法可以做到这一点。
在运行时使用 javax.tools 包,然后使用 ClassLoader 。
如果您正在编写接口,可以使用代理。
字节码操作/生成,使用 BCEL 或 ASM (后者对语言功能(如注释)有更多的最新支持),然后使用ClassLoader加载类。

java 种的File类是用来做什么的?有什么用处?(追加40分): File 是文件,表示一个磁盘上的实体文件,可以是文件夹,或是普通的文件。
你可以创建新的文件;
你可以用同样在 io 包里的其他类例如 FileReader 和 FileWriter 对一个 File 对象进行读写操作。例如你可以打开一个 txt 文件,读出里面所有的内容,同样可以把新的内容写进去;
你可以删除一个文件;
利用上面提到的输入输出类可以实现文件的复制(创建一个同名的 File,然后从原始文件中读取所有内容,写入到新的 File 中);
你可以实现文件的剪切(在复制的基础上删掉原文件);
当然你也可以重命名。
----------------------------------------
还有你问出这样的问题肯定是学习方法出问题了。教程就是教你怎么用的,你看完反问这个问题,说明你看教程的目的错了。你不是要理解这个视频,而是要利用这个视频。我遇到过无数的 Java 初学者,他们都是为了看视频而看视频,一边苦逼地看,一边念念有词地记,甚至做笔记啥的——完全错了!自己多练习练习,写点程序,才是对的,视频说穿了根本不需要看,遇到不会的看看文档:
http://download.oracle.com/javase/7/docs/api/
文档才是王道。File 类你可以自己看一下有多少方法,每个方法都有明确的解释,还有 io 包里的其他类,包括我提到的那两个,都有明确的解释,你好好看看。
当然不是要求你一次性全给背下来。一旦你出现死记硬背的想法了,老毛病就犯了。你要的是练习,遇到没学过或者有些遗忘的地方上来当手册一样查一下。

  • pc材料是什么

    为什么qq浏览器搜索越来越慢: 总体来说影响网页打开速度的主要有如下几方面:1、系统有病毒,尤其是蠕虫类病毒,严重消耗系统资源,打不开页面,甚至死机。2、ACTIVEX插件.过多3、流氓软件..给IE装上了各种搜索工具条之类的拖慢IE启动速度4、I...

    248条评论 1608人喜欢 4995次阅读 931人点赞
  • dnf泰拉石做多久

    为什么点了一下下载附件,浏览器就卡死了。: IE 出问题了 在安全设置里面设置一下就可以了 IE 工具 选项 之后找到安全设置 更改就可以了 ...

    502条评论 4033人喜欢 4605次阅读 380人点赞
  • eas是什么

    武汉哪里有蹦极的地方啊。?: 武汉龟山风景区 ① 景区开放时间:景区游览:9:00— 17:30索道、蹦极:9:00—17:00 ②凡蹦极者进入龟山需购买龟山门票,龟山门票成人15元(注:景区在举办活动期间,龟山门票价格以当日票价为准)。③ 1....

    661条评论 1090人喜欢 5639次阅读 692人点赞
  • ncis里tony好几个

    "不为五斗米折腰"最早是指谁不愿为五斗米折腰: 这个成语来源于《晋书陶潜传》:“吾不能为五斗米折腰,拳拳事乡里小人邪。” 陶渊明为了养家糊口,就去做了县令。但县令的俸禄只够买五斗米。一天,上级派督邮来督察。为人骄横的督邮一到彭泽县就差人把陶渊明叫来见自己,而且要...

    727条评论 4649人喜欢 5659次阅读 790人点赞
  • 1937年美国大衰退多少间银行倒闭

    嗯哼嗯哼蹦擦擦是哪首dj歌曲的: YY最高人气女歌手苏三的 八连杀 她很多歌都不错 人也狠赞 ...

    313条评论 5660人喜欢 1716次阅读 643人点赞
  • oppon3多少钱

    蹦迪怎么蹦啊,看他们怎么蹦的那么好,我怎么就蹦不好呢?: 这些一般都是自己想出来的或你可以参考那些钢管舞 ...

    452条评论 1201人喜欢 6039次阅读 780人点赞
  • 12345iloveyou谁唱的

    IE浏览器为什么不能在同一窗口打开多个选项卡?: 这是设置问题 打开ie浏览器的internet设置进行设置一下 有个选项 然后关闭浏览器 或者重启下即生效 ...

    790条评论 1210人喜欢 5631次阅读 870人点赞